Jonas Bros want to write 'New Moon' song

Speaking to MTV, the popstars said that they are huge fans of Stephenie Meyer's vampire franchise, and would love the chance to be involved in the film adaptation of the follow-up to last year's Twilight.
"[Twilight] was obviously a huge success, and if they asked us to be a part of [the sequel], that would be great," said Nick Jonas. "It would be really cool."
However, he confessed that the band's hectic schedule meant they had not actually seen the first film yet: "We're looking forward to seeing it. We've been a little busy, so it's kinda hard to get the movies, but we'll see it."
Older brother Kevin added: "Typically, we'll get the advance DVDs and watch them on plane rides or something. So hopefully we'll do that."
The Twilight soundtrack, which featured Paramore and Linkin Park, was a commercial success on release last year.
